About F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ER
F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ER is a large nursing home located in Rocky Mount, Virginia, operated by LIFEWORKS REHAB. Its CMS Five-Star overall rating is 4 out of 5 — above average for VA. Health inspections rate 4/5, staffing 1/5, and quality measures 5/5.
F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ER is one of 2 nursing homes in Rocky Mount, Virginia. The suburb average is 3★, and F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ER rates 4★ overall. It currently scores at or above every other home in Rocky Mount on overall rating.

What does F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ER cost?
F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ER does not publish a public rate sheet. The figures below are state and national median monthly costs for nursing home care, based on the Genworth Cost of Care Survey. Use them as a planning benchmark — request a written quote from FRANKLIN HEALTH AND REHABILITATION CENTER for your specific room type, level of care, and Medicaid status.
| Room type | Virginia median | National median | Annual (Virginia)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Semi-private room | $8,243/mo | $8,669/mo | $98,916 |
| Private room | $9,277/mo | $9,733/mo | $111,324 |
Estimates only. Actual prices vary by room, care level, and payor source. See our guide to paying for a nursing home and VA Aid & Attendance benefits.

Five-Star Quality Ratings are published by the U.S.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) using data from health inspections, payroll-based staffing reports, and clinical quality measures. Ratings reflect the most recent CMS extract we have imported — always confirm current ratings on Medicare.gov Care Compare before making care decisions.
